Teachers are always asking for creativity apps instead of just games that students play while working on the computer or the iPad. Over the years, I have shared out all kinds of project based programs that the students can use while working with technology. Some of my favorite include Prezi, Thinglink, PowToons, and TimeToast. However, those websites require a password, email address, and take some students extra time to just figure out the program. When faced with those roadblocks, I turn the teachers to ReadWriteThink.
